码迷,mamicode.com
首页 >  
搜索关键字:AC    ( 12438个结果
[C#] 逆袭——自制日刷千题的AC自动机攻克HDU OJ
前言 做过杭电、浙大或是北大等ACM题库的人一定对“刷题”不陌生,以杭电OJ为例:首先打开首页(http://acm.hdu.edu.cn/),然后登陆,接着找到“Online Exercise”下的“Problem Archive”,然后从众多题目中选择一个进行读题、构思、编程、然后提交、最后查....
分类:Windows程序   时间:2015-03-15 00:35:00    阅读次数:341
BestCoder Round #33
1.zhx's submissions问题描述作为史上最强的刷子之一,zhx在各大oj上交了很多份代码,而且多数都AC了。有一天,zhx想数一数他在n个oj上一共交了多少份代码。他现在已经统计出在第i个oj上,他交了ai份代码。而把它们加起来就是你的工作了。当然zhx是一个不走寻常路的人,所以他的数...
分类:其他好文   时间:2015-03-14 22:59:29    阅读次数:437
ZOJ 3494
超级神奇有趣题。AC自动机+数位DP。其实,数位DP在处理含有某些数字时特别不好处理,应该把它倒转为求不含有。这道题把数位DP+AC自动机结合起来,实在是很巧妙,把数字变为串来处理,强大!要使用AC自动机来处理数位DP,首先就是要确定哪些状态由当前状态开始是不可以到达的,有哪些是可以到达的。这是显而...
分类:其他好文   时间:2015-03-14 22:58:29    阅读次数:258
POJ 3087 Shuffle'm Up 线性同余,暴力 难度:2
http://poj.org/problem?id=3087设:s1={A1,A2,A3,...Ac}s2={Ac+1,Ac+2,Ac+3,....A2c}则合在一起成为Ac+1,A1,Ac+2,A2......A2c,Ac经过一次转换之后变成s1={Ac+1,A1,Ac+2.....}s2={.....
分类:其他好文   时间:2015-03-14 21:39:59    阅读次数:115
bzoj 2938
收获: 1、AC自动机可以在建立fail时将一些不存在的儿子指针指向对应的位置。 2、判断环时不要想当然地写个这样的版本:bool dfs( int u ) { if( vis[u] ) return true; vis[u] = true; for( int t=0; t11...
分类:其他好文   时间:2015-03-14 21:25:47    阅读次数:165
android常用权限
在AndroidManifest.xml文件的标签中添加如下代码就可以在软件中获取相应的权限。访问登记属性android.permission.ACCESS_CHECKIN_PROPERTIES ,读取或写入登记check-in数据库属性表的权限获取错略位置android.permission.AC...
分类:移动开发   时间:2015-03-14 19:53:24    阅读次数:178
bzoj 2434 ac自动机
ac自动机中,如果以trie中的节点为节点,(fail[i],i)为边,可以建立一颗树,该树有如下特点:“节点u是节点v的祖先 当且仅当 u代表的字符串是v代表的字符串的一个后缀”。(u代表的字符串是由根节点到u路径上所有的边代表的字符顺次组合成的,我们记作str(u))。本题中的每一个P都对应tr...
分类:其他好文   时间:2015-03-14 16:50:49    阅读次数:150
[LeetCode]Repeated DNA Sequences,解题报告
目录目录 前言 题目 Native思路 二进制思路 AC前言最近在LeetCode上能一次AC的概率越来越低了,我这里也是把每次不能一次AC的题目记录下来,把解题思路分享给大家。题目All DNA is composed of a series of nucleotides abbreviated as A, C, G, and T, for example: “ACGAATTCCG”. When...
分类:其他好文   时间:2015-03-14 12:30:04    阅读次数:201
【COGS1672】【SPOJ375】QTREE
这是我的第一个边权链剖 COGS上和SPOJ有点不一样就是没有多组数据了本质还是一样的 我写的是COGS那个其实改一改就可以去SPOJ AC了= -= (可是我现在上不去SPOJ卧槽(╯‵□′)╯︵┻━┻) 【题目描述】一天机房的夜晚,无数人在MC里奋斗着。。。大家都知道矿产对于MC来说是多么的重要,但由于矿越挖越少,勇士们不得不跑到更远的地方挖矿,但这样路途上就会花费相当大的时间,导致挖...
分类:其他好文   时间:2015-03-14 09:36:58    阅读次数:161
蓝桥杯 BASIC-10~12 进制转化
十进制转十六进制 【AC代码】:更简单采用直接输出的方式。 #include #include #include using namespace std; int main() { //freopen("in.txt", "r", stdin); //freopen("out.txt", "w", stdout); int n = 0, cnt = 0, i = 0; cin ...
分类:其他好文   时间:2015-03-13 22:23:24    阅读次数:178
© 2014 mamicode.com 版权所有  联系我们:gaon5@hotmail.com
迷上了代码!